Though specific backup prices vary based on instance details, you can usually expect portions ranging from 33% to 40% of the complete problems recuperated. A lot of injury legal representatives deal with a backup cost basis, which suggests they only get paid if your case succeeds. The regular contingency charge drops between 33-1/3% and 40% of any type of award, with the exact percent flexible and laid out in the contingency fee contract. Some companies charge 40% if the situation works out during the insurance claims phase and 50% or more if the case litigates.
